Equinox Consulting is a Luxembourg-based space mission engineering consultancy. It is not positioned as a traditional SaaS or enterprise software provider, but rather offers independent engineering and project delivery services for space projects such as satellites, constellations, ground segments, quantum communications, and 5G-NTN. Its value proposition is to help clients move from mission concept through launch, LEOP, and in-orbit operations, allowing them to focus on business goals and financing.
Based on the website information, its services cover the full space mission lifecycle: concept and feasibility, design and analysis, build and qualification, launch and LEOP, operations, and ongoing support. Key capabilities include spectrum management and ITU coordination, NGSO/GEO coexistence and interference analysis, mission analysis and systems engineering, subsystem engineering for spacecraft thermal control/power/AOCS/propulsion/RF/flight control, PMP project management, ground segment and mission control architecture, OaaS operational support, and QKD quantum communication solutions. It also emphasizes familiarity with ECSS, CCSDS, PUS, NASA NPR, ITU-R, 3GPP, and ITAR-related requirements.
The website does not disclose packages, unit pricing, subscription models, or free trial information. Judging from the content, Equinox is more of a project-based professional consulting and engineering delivery service than a software platform that can be self-purchased and deployed. There is also no indication of typical enterprise software capabilities such as APIs, SDKs, developer documentation, account permissions, or a SaaS integration marketplace.
Its strengths are its high level of vertical specialization, covering complex scenarios from CubeSats to GEO platforms, and from LEOP to spectrum coordination and quantum communications. It also emphasizes independent consulting, without being tied to specific hardware or platforms, which should theoretically support more objective solution selection. Its client and partner mix includes space agencies and companies such as ESA, SES, DLR, and Northrop Grumman, which adds industry credibility. The main weaknesses are a lack of business transparency: pricing, delivery boundaries, team size, SLA details, and measurable case outcomes are not clearly disclosed. For companies looking for a standard SaaS tool, the fit is relatively low.
It is better suited to space startups, satellite operators, research institutions, government/EU project teams, and companies planning space missions—especially customers that need spectrum, systems engineering, LEOP, or ground segment capabilities.
